Regular biography

Bimlesh WADHWA is an Associate Professor (Educator Track) in the Department of Computer Science at the National University of Singapore. Her research and teaching interests include software engineering, interaction design, information visualization, and computing education. She has developed and taught several courses in software engineering and human-computer interaction. Dr. Wadhwa has contributed to book chapters and presented her research at major conferences. She is a founding member of the Centre for Computing for Social Good and Philanthropy at NUS and initiated the Code for Community programme. She also serves in various academic and student-related roles, including acting Chair of ACM-w Asia Pacific and Faculty representative for the Singapore Computer Society Student Chapter.
